1994 850T Cuts out... 850

Hey All,

I'm a newbie to this forum.

Just a quick question, I notice that there are some threads about this topic, but I have some idiosyncrasies with my problem:

Symptoms: Once, I was driving the car on the highway, and when I went to press the gas, nothing happened, like the pedal didnt increase RPMs. Removed my foot, tried again and it worked. On that same trip, I stopped at a gas station and tried to crank the car after fueling up, and it failed to turn over and start. Had to sit there for 5 mins and then eventually got the car running. Fast forward 6 weeks. Now the car seems to die on me at random intervals. I'll be driving along, thet car will crap out, all dashboard lights will illuminate, and power steering will be lost. Sometimes stopping the car and re-starting the engine will work, sometimes you have to wait 5 mins. The only commonalities that I can see in each of these incidences (talking about recent crapouts) is that the car was stopped at an intersection for a long time and/or the car is driving along at low speed/RPM (i.e. engine is not constantly going, more like coasting down a hill, push the gas a little, 1500 rpm, let go, ec.)

Attempts at solutions: I've taken the car to the mechanic, he agreed to take it home for a week and drive it. The car must be haunted because nothing happened with him. We recently replaced the O2 sensor (but the initial highway and gas station incidents occured before O2 replacement), and yesterday we went to the mechanic with the car (after we had it back and it conked), he did the diagnostic, and a 325 code came on for the #2 socket I think. Now we're looking at replacing the Bosch computer boards (don't know what they're called, but they're next to the diagnostic plug), but somehow I think the problem is more fuel system related.
